The Cleveland Cavaliers' NBA Finals odds dropped to +3000 on May 20, one day after New York beat Cleveland 115-104 in overtime in Game 1 of the Eastern Conference finals at Madison Square Garden. Sports Illustrated reported that DraftKings had moved Cleveland from +2000 before the loss to +3000 afterward. The May 19 result turned on a late collapse. NBA.com said the Knicks closed on a 44-11 run and completed a 22-point fourth-quarter comeback, with Jalen Brunson leading New York's rally. Sports Illustrated's betting analysis called it Cleveland "blowing a golden chance" in the series opener. ### How big was the move in Cleveland's title price? DraftKings' shift from +2000 to +3000 was the clearest market reaction to the opener. (si.com) Sports Illustrated said the new number implied a 3.23% chance of Cleveland winning the NBA title. Before the conference finals began, the same outlet had listed the Cavaliers at +2000 and still behind the other three teams left in the playoffs. (nba.com) The May 20 adjustment came after Cleveland lost home-court leverage in the series. NBA.com's playoff page listed New York's win as the first game of the Eastern Conference finals and framed it as a historic comeback at Madison Square Garden. ### What actually happened in Game 1 at Madison Square Garden? New York won 115-104 in overtime on May 19 after trailing by 22 points in the fourth quarter. (si.com) NBA.com's game summary listed Donovan Mitchell with 29 points for Cleveland, while Brunson led the Knicks' comeback. Madison Square Garden was the site of one of the stranger conference-finals openers in recent playoff history. (si.com) A conference-finals opener can move title markets because only four teams remain and each result changes the path to the Finals. Sports Illustrated had already listed Cleveland as the longest shot of the four remaining teams before Game 1, behind Oklahoma City, San Antonio and New York. (si.com) The May 19 loss made that path steeper. ESPN's playoff schedule page said the 2026 NBA Finals are set to begin on June 3, leaving Cleveland with limited room to recover if New York extends its series lead. ### What comes next for Cleveland and New York? The Eastern Conference finals continue in New York after the Knicks took a 1-0 lead on May 19. (si.com) NBA.com's series page lists the Cavaliers and Knicks as the East finalists, and ESPN's playoff schedule says the NBA Finals begin June 3 on ABC. For bettors, the next checkpoint is whether Cleveland can level the series and force another adjustment in the market. (espn.com) For the teams, the immediate next step is Game 2 at Madison Square Garden, with New York trying to protect home court and Cleveland trying to reverse the odds slide reported after Game 1.
